Nichols Edged By Western New England, 1-0

DUDLEY, Mass. – Freshman Sarah Marois (Waterford, N.Y.) scored in the 51st minute to lift Western New England past host Nichols 1-0 in a Commonwealth Coast Conference women's soccer match played at Michael J. Vendetti Field on Saturday morning.

The first half ended in a 0-0 draw. Nichols junior Shelby Aminti (Pepperell, Mass.) had the best opportunity of the frame as she tried to deposit a free kick at 35:48. The first 45 minutes saw Western New England outshoot the Bison 10-4 and take three of the four corner kicks awarded.

Marois broke up the stalemate at 50:18 when she knocked home a rebound that caromed off the post. Senior Alexis Bshara (West Springfield, Mass.) took the initial shot to setup the scoring opportunity. Sophomore Tayler Mazurski (Wolcott, Conn.) had a chance to net an insurance marker 14 minutes later but her attempt went to the left of the goal. The Golden Bears had a 5-1 advantage in the shot column and doubled up the Bison 2-1 on corner kicks.

Rookie Western New England goalkeeper Briana Kubik (Blandford, Mass.) turned away four shots while moving to 6-7-1 on the season. First-year Bison netminder Melissa Toomey (Saugus, Mass.) collected seven saves in the setback.

Nichols (3-7-2, 0-5-0 CCC) entertains Mount Ida on Thursday at 3:30 p.m. while the Golden Bears (6-7-1, 1-4-0 CCC) travel to Mass. College of Liberal Arts on Wednesday to take on the Trailblazers at 4:00 p.m.
